Women's Walking Rugby 

 

Walking Rugby at Moore RUFC has been bringing energy, laughter, and community spirit to the club since its launch in 2019, made possible with the support of the Sale Sharks Foundation. What started as a small, welcoming initiative has grown into a thriving, inclusive group where people of all ages and abilities can enjoy the game in a relaxed and supportive environment. At its heart, Walking Rugby is about participation and connection—whether you're returning to the sport after years away or trying it for the very first time, you'll find a friendly face and a place on the pitch.

In 2026, the club proudly introduced a dedicated Ladies Walking Rugby side, coached by Rebecca Leanne. Designed especially for those new to rugby, it offers a fantastic opportunity to learn the basics, build confidence, and enjoy being active in a fun, pressure-free setting. It’s more than just a session—it’s a growing community of like-minded women who come together each week to stay fit, develop new skills, and make lasting friendships. The emphasis is always on enjoyment, encouragement, and shared achievement.

Walking Rugby itself is a non-contact version of the traditional game, making it accessible and safe while still capturing all the excitement and teamwork that rugby is known for. It provides a brilliant cardio workout, helping to improve fitness, flexibility, and overall wellbeing, all without the physical demands of full-contact play. Both the mixed and ladies sessions take place at the club every Thursday from 7–8pm, completely free of charge, and boots can even be loaned if needed. As part of the national Walking Rugby Association and supported by Cheshire RFU, Moore RUFC is proud to offer this fantastic initiative to the local community.
